Labrador Retrievers are a versatile and popular breed of dog known for their loyalty and adorable temperament. They belong to the Sporting Group, along with other gun dogs like Golden Retrievers, Pointers, and Irish Setters, as they are known for their skill in retrieving game. During the 1800s, fishing families in Newfoundland, Canada bred Labradors to help fishermen with their daily tasks like retrieving fish and fowl from icy waters. Now,Labradors are often kept as family pets due to their sunny disposition, trainability, and natural affinity for children and other pets.
Labrador Retrievers are generally not considered to be hypoallergenic, though there are some low-shedding coat varieties that may cause fewer allergic reactions. While some people with allergies may not be affected by Labradors, it's important to understand that no dog is truly hypoallergenic since all dogs produce dander, which is a common allergen. The best way to assess a potential allergy to Labradors is to spend time with the breed and observe any allergic reactions that may occur.
The best dog food for Labradors can depend on a few factors. The age and weight of your pet, their activity level, and any special dietary needs or sensitivities should all be taken into account when selecting a food for your pup. Generally, it's recommended to look for food made with natural ingredients that are high in protein, specifically animal-sourced proteins, with moderate levels of fat and carbohydrates.
Before bringing home your Labrador Retriever, it's important to make sure you have all the necessary essentials. Start by picking up a quality collar and leash. You'll also want to invest in a sturdy crate and plenty of toys; chew toys will help with teething, and rubber toys will last longer with harder chewers. Don't forget bowls for food and water, a bed to keep your pup comfortable, and some dog grooming supplies (shampoo, brushes, and nail trimmers). Lastly, be sure to buy food that's specially formulated for your Lab's age and size.
No, Labrador Retrievers are not considered small dogs. They are actually classified as a medium-sized breed. They usually range in height from 21.5 to 24.5 inches and in weight from 55 to 80 pounds. It's important to note that males typically weigh more than females. Labradors have a thick double coat that requires regular grooming and a significant amount of exercise to remain healthy and avoid behavior issues. They are intelligent, loyal, and energetic, so they make great companions for people who are up for long walks and playtime.
Labrador Retrievers are an active breed of dog, and they need plenty of physical and mental exercise to stay healthy and engaged. Depending on the age of your Lab, a minimum of 30-60 minutes of physical activity and mental stimulation daily or every other day is ideal. A combination of aerobic exercise, such as walking, running, and swimming, plus interactive activities like fetch, agility, and disc games can help satisfy a Lab's physical energy needs. Mental exercises, such as tug of war or hide and seek, help satisfy a Lab's curious and independent nature.
Labrador Retrievers are some of the most popular breeds and make an excellent choice for first-time dog owners. They are quick to learn commands and are generally very social and friendly, which can help ease the transition for a first-time owner. Labradors are typically very trainable and usually make excellent family pets that are wonderful with children. They are also relatively easy to care for and have moderate energy and exercise needs. With their pleasing personalities and affectionate nature, Labradors can be a great addition to a first-time dog owner's family.
Yes, Labrador Retrievers are widely regarded as one of the smartest breeds of dog. They rank among the top ten dogs in terms of intelligence, and are known for their curiosity and inquisitiveness. Labradors are easily trainable, and respond very well to instruction. They are also known for their loyalty and obedience. They are easy to house-train, adjust quickly to new environments, and form strong connections with their owners. Labradors are also adaptable to a variety of activities, making them a great pet choice for owners with an active lifestyle.
